Macrophage (MACK-roe-fayj)
A phagocyte that "eats"
dead tissue and degenerated cells. Approximately 50% of all macrophages are Kupffer cells,
which are found in the liver.
Magnesium
A macromineral that is a part of more than 300 enzymes in the human body. Thus, magnesium is involved in the
creation of ATP and muscle contraction; carbohydrate metabolism
and insulin function; transmission of the genetic code, and countless other vital
functions.

MAOI
Monoamine oxidase inhibitor (mon-owe-AM-in-OX-si-dayse)
A drug that inhibits the enzyme
monoamine oxidase. This enzyme degrades (breaks down) neurotransmitters
reducing the effectiveness of noradrenaline (NA), serotonin, and dopamine. They
should not be taken with drugs (like ECA) that increase the
release of these neurotransmitters because this could lead to dangerous overstimulation.
